能耗系統(tǒng)在馬來(lái)西亞連鎖餐飲業(yè)的應(yīng)用

發(fā)布時(shí)間: 2023-01-03  點(diǎn)擊次數(shù): 861次

安科瑞 繆凱倫

Application of energy consumption system in chain catering industry in Malaysia

1.背景信息 Background

針對(duì)連鎖餐飲業(yè)能耗高且能源管理不合理的問(wèn)題,利用計(jì)算機(jī)網(wǎng)絡(luò)技術(shù)、通訊技術(shù)、計(jì)量控制技術(shù)等信息化技術(shù),實(shí)現(xiàn)能源資源分類分項(xiàng)計(jì)量和能源資源運(yùn)行監(jiān)管功能,清晰描述各分店總的用能現(xiàn)狀;實(shí)時(shí)監(jiān)測(cè)各供電回路的電壓、電流和功率等電力參數(shù),識(shí)別有效負(fù)荷與無(wú)效能耗,從而可通過(guò)技術(shù)實(shí)現(xiàn)合理節(jié)能。

Aiming at the problems of high energy consumption and unreasonable energy management in the chain catering industry, information technologies such as computer network technology, communication technology and measurement and control technology are used to realize the function of energy resource classification and sub-metering and energy resource operation supervision, and clearly describe the overall energy use status of each branch.

Real-time monitoring of the voltage, current, power and other power parameters of each power supply circuit to identify the effective load and invalid energy consumption, so as to achieve effective energy-saving through technology.

2.項(xiàng)目信息 Project Information

本項(xiàng)目為Abbaco Controls Sdn Bhd針對(duì)本地連鎖餐飲業(yè)50個(gè)分店,共200個(gè)用電回路進(jìn)行能耗信息采集,希望通過(guò)安科瑞能耗系統(tǒng)解決基礎(chǔ)能耗數(shù)據(jù)的智能化、自動(dòng)化、可視化、可量化的收集與存儲(chǔ),從而降低能源使用費(fèi)用。

This project is designed for Abbaco Controls Sdn Bhd to collect energy consumption information for a total of 200 electrical circuits in 50 branches of the local chain catering industry. It hopes to solve the intelligent, automatic, visual and quantifiable collection and storage of basic energy consumption data through Acrel Energy Consumption system, so as to reduce the energy use cost.

3.系統(tǒng)架構(gòu) Structure

安科瑞Acrel-5000能耗分析管理系統(tǒng)以工作站主機(jī)、通訊設(shè)備、測(cè)控單元為基本工具,為大型公共建筑的實(shí)時(shí)數(shù)據(jù)采集及遠(yuǎn)程管理提供了基礎(chǔ)平臺(tái),它可以和其他樓宇自動(dòng)化系統(tǒng)進(jìn)行數(shù)據(jù)轉(zhuǎn)發(fā)構(gòu)成復(fù)雜的監(jiān)控系統(tǒng)。該能耗系統(tǒng)主要采用分層分布式計(jì)算機(jī)網(wǎng)絡(luò)結(jié)構(gòu),如系統(tǒng)結(jié)構(gòu)圖所示:

Acrel-5000 energy consumption analysis and management system takes workstation host machine, communication equipment and measurement and control unit as basic tools, and provides a basic platform for real-time data collection and remote management of large public buildings. It can transmit data with other building automation systems to form a complex monitoring system.

The energy consumption system mainly adopts the layered distributed computer network structure, as follows:

4.主要功能 Main Function

4.1能耗綜合主界面 Platform Overview

通過(guò)系統(tǒng)主界面可以反映各分店用能各分類能耗和折算為標(biāo)準(zhǔn)煤的綜合能耗,并計(jì)算單位面積能耗。

The main interface of the system can reflect the energy consumption of each branch and the comprehensive energy consumption converted into standard coal, and calculate the energy consumption per unit area.

image.png


4.2分項(xiàng)用電數(shù)據(jù)統(tǒng)計(jì) Itemized electricity consumption data statistics

將電耗進(jìn)行逐時(shí)、逐日、逐月、逐年統(tǒng)計(jì)。統(tǒng)計(jì)數(shù)據(jù)采用餅圖、柱狀圖、線圖、區(qū)域圖等各種圖形展示方式,直觀反映各項(xiàng)統(tǒng)計(jì)數(shù)據(jù)的數(shù)值、趨勢(shì)和分布情況。

The system makes hourly, daily, month-by-month and year-by-year statistics of power consumption.The statistical data are presented by pie chart, bar chart, line chart, area chart and other graphics, which can directly reflect the value, trend and distribution of various statistical data.

image.png


4.3用電支路趨勢(shì)分析 Trend analysis of branch circuit

統(tǒng)計(jì)各區(qū)域、各設(shè)備電能消耗,準(zhǔn)確定位用電消耗回路,制定節(jié)能績(jī)效考核制度,推動(dòng)節(jié)能降耗的合理執(zhí)行。為用能設(shè)備建立運(yùn)行記錄檔案,長(zhǎng)期跟蹤記錄設(shè)備運(yùn)行過(guò)程中的能效分析評(píng)估結(jié)果,結(jié)合設(shè)備維護(hù)保養(yǎng)記錄,為設(shè)備的運(yùn)行維護(hù)提供依據(jù)。

Make statistics on the power consumption of each region and equipment, accurately locate the power consumption circuit, formulate the performance appraisal system of energy conservation, and promote the effective implementation of energy conservation and consumption reduction.

In order to establish operation record files for energy-using equipment, track and record the energy efficiency analysis and evaluation results in the operation process of the equipment for a long time, and provide basis for the operation and maintenance of the equipment in combination with the equipment maintenance record.

image.png


4.4能耗數(shù)據(jù)同環(huán)比分析 Comparative analysis of energy consumption data

將各種類型和各主要耗能設(shè)備的能耗與去年同期值和上月值進(jìn)行同比環(huán)比分析,檢驗(yàn)節(jié)能效果,根據(jù)分析結(jié)果執(zhí)行節(jié)能績(jī)效考核,以及節(jié)能目標(biāo)的修正。

The energy consumption of various types and major energy-consuming equipment was analyzed on a year-on-year basis with the values of the same period last year and the values of the last month, and the energy-saving effect was tested. According to the analysis results, the energy-saving performance assessment was carried out and the energy-saving target was revised.

image.png


4.5能耗數(shù)據(jù)分時(shí)統(tǒng)計(jì) Time-division statistics of energy consumption data

將能源類型、負(fù)載類型、區(qū)域能耗按照時(shí)間區(qū)分,按時(shí)、天、月、年、工作日、非工作日等對(duì)用能數(shù)據(jù)進(jìn)行對(duì)比分析,掌握能源具體消耗情況。可將每天用能按時(shí)段設(shè)置峰、平、谷,統(tǒng)計(jì)各時(shí)段能耗,降低閑時(shí)能耗。

Classify the energy type, load type and regional energy consumption according to time, and compare and analyze the energy data on time, day, month, year, working day and non-working day, so as to grasp the specific energy consumption.Peak, level and valley can be set in the time period of daily energy use, and energy consumption of each period can be counted to reduce energy consumption in idle time.

image.png


4.6電能數(shù)據(jù)實(shí)時(shí)監(jiān)測(cè)和預(yù)警 Real-time monitoring and early warning of electric power data

通過(guò)高精度智能儀表以技術(shù)手段實(shí)現(xiàn)自動(dòng)化全實(shí)時(shí)、高密度的實(shí)時(shí)用能監(jiān)測(cè),減少用能的計(jì)量誤差。實(shí)時(shí)監(jiān)視現(xiàn)場(chǎng)儀表的回傳數(shù)據(jù),對(duì)電能進(jìn)行合理的管控和預(yù)警,及時(shí)發(fā)現(xiàn)并改正運(yùn)行中存在的用電異常,隨時(shí)處理。按需設(shè)置重要設(shè)備的超標(biāo)預(yù)警值,超標(biāo)時(shí)醒目提醒并主動(dòng)記錄。

Automatic real-time and high-density real-time energy-using monitoring can be realized by high-precision intelligent instrument with technical means to reduce the measurement error of energy-using.

Monitor the back data of the field instruments in real time, control and warn the electric energy reasonably, find and correct the abnormal electricity in the operation in time, and deal with it at any time.

The warning value of exceeding the standard of important equipment is set as required. When exceeding the standard, it should be reminded and recorded actively.
